About dimethyl 3-methyl-5-[(3,4,5-triethoxybenzoyl)amino]thiophene-2,4-dicarboxylate
dimethyl 3-methyl-5-[(3,4,5-triethoxybenzoyl)amino]thiophene-2,4-dicarboxylate (PubChem CID 2933338) has the molecular formula C22H27NO8S
and a molecular weight of 465.52 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is dimethyl 3-methyl-5-[(3,4,5-triethoxybenzoyl)amino]thiophene-2,4-dicarboxylate.

What is the SMILES notation for dimethyl 3-methyl-5-[(3,4,5-triethoxybenzoyl)amino]thiophene-2,4-dicarboxylate?
The canonical SMILES for dimethyl 3-methyl-5-[(3,4,5-triethoxybenzoyl)amino]thiophene-2,4-dicarboxylate is CCOc1cc(C(=O)Nc2sc(C(=O)OC)c(C)c2C(=O)OC)cc(OCC)c1OCC.
What is the InChIKey of dimethyl 3-methyl-5-[(3,4,5-triethoxybenzoyl)amino]thiophene-2,4-dicarboxylate?
The InChIKey is WQSSRFQIIKOBEA-UHFFFAOYSA-N. The full InChI is InChI=1S/C22H27NO8S/c1-7-29-14-10-13(11-15(30-8-2)17(14)31-9-3)19(24)23-20-16(21(25)27-5)12(4)18(32-20)22(26)28-6/h10-11H,7-9H2,1-6H3,(H,23,24).
What are the key properties of dimethyl 3-methyl-5-[(3,4,5-triethoxybenzoyl)amino]thiophene-2,4-dicarboxylate?
dimethyl 3-methyl-5-[(3,4,5-triethoxybenzoyl)amino]thiophene-2,4-dicarboxylate has a molecular weight of 465.52 g/mol, XLogP of 4.08, 10 rotatable bonds, 1 hydrogen bond donors, and 9 hydrogen bond acceptors.
